Output 63102f6de9dfc02c6b282c85656a078c50c7573ff56c20bdc91059b1f3d42672:8

value
100584
script pubkey
OP_0 OP_PUSHBYTES_20 30acd738120e163f75d25679847508cf3c4e15d1
address
bc1qxzkdwwqjpctr7awj2eucgaggeu7yu9w38rh52u
transaction
63102f6de9dfc02c6b282c85656a078c50c7573ff56c20bdc91059b1f3d42672
spent
true